PT Bank Sinarmas (the company) was established under its original name of PT Bank Shinta Indonesia base on notarial deed No.52 of Mr Buniarti Tjandra, S.H, dated on 18 Aug, 1989. The Company’s articles of association has been amended several times, most recently by notarial deed No.31 of Sutjipto, S.H., dated Apr 6 2010, concerning among others, change in par value, the name of the company, and public offering.
